Illinois Gas Prices Stabilize as Winter Driving Season Draws Near

AURORA, Ill., Sept. 17 -- According to AAA Chicago's most recent fuel gauge report, gas prices have remained relatively stable for the past month, with an average price of $1.46 per gallon for regular unleaded gasoline throughout Illinois. Prices in northern Indiana are relatively stable as well, with only a slight 3-cent increase over last month's prices. Prices in Illinois are up .008 cents from last month's average of $1.45 per gallon, although many Illinois counties are showing slight decreases.

In Cook County, self-serve regular unleaded gasoline now averages $1.563 per gallon, which is down .01 cents from last month.

In DuPage County, self-serve regular unleaded gasoline now averages $1.511 per gallon, .01 cent lower than August prices.

In Kane County, self-serve regular unleaded gasoline averages $1.457 per gallon, which is the same as last month's prices.

In Lake County, self-serve regular unleaded gasoline averages $1.454 per gallon, 4 cents lower than August prices.

In McHenry County, self-serve regular unleaded gasoline averages $1.456 per gallon, 1 cent lower than August prices.

In Will County, self-serve regular unleaded gasoline averages $1.473 per gallon, .005 cents higher than August prices.

In northern Indiana, self-serve regular unleaded gasoline averages $1.387 per gallon, 3 cents higher than last month.

"Motorists should begin to see prices slowly decrease as we move closer to the winter driving season as more expensive summer-grade fuels are phased out of production," said Steve Nolan, spokesman for AAA Chicago. "Additionally, Iraq's decision to let UN inspectors inside the Middle Eastern country has helped ease the price of crude oil futures."
